1 held for attempt to murder

By Correspondent

BONGAIGAON, Nov 22 - The police on Saturday arrested Kumar Prithiviraj Narayan Deb (18), the self-styled president of the Royal Union of Koch-Mech, on two separate charges registered against him this month at the Basugaon Police Station in Chirang district. and produced him before the District Judicial Court at Kajalgaon, the district headquarters, from where he was sent to 14-day judicial custody.

Prithiviraj, son of Pradip Narayan Deb of Goglapara, Basugaon, had allegedly made a failed attempt to kill his wife at Bhutiapra on November 1.

Prithiviraj�s wife is a minor and a resident of Hekaipara, Basugaon, whom he had forcibly married three months ago, the girl�s family alleged.

Following the incident, the girl�s family had lodged a complaint against Prithiviraj at the Basugaon Police Station on November 1. Accordingly, the police had registered a case (No. 161/2015) under Section 366 (A)/307 of the IPC (read with Child Marriage Act 2005).

Two local media persons, who covered the incident of Prithiviraj�s alleged attack on his wife in their respective newspapers, filed another FIR against Prithiviraj at the same police station on November 7 after they were allegedly threatened by him on the social media.

The police have registered another case (No. 162/2005) under Sections 505(2)/504/506 of the IPC against the self-styled leader of the Koch-Mech group and initiated an investigation.
